Is NATO membership the golden ticket to peace in Ukraine? 🇺🇦✨ That's what Ukrainian President Volodymyr Zelenskyy believes! In a bold move, Zelenskyy announced he's ready to end the \"hot phase\" of the ongoing conflict with Russia if Ukraine can join the North Atlantic Treaty Organization (NATO).
\"If we want to stop the hot phase of the war, we need to put the territory of Ukraine that is under our control under the NATO umbrella. We need to do it fast,\" Zelenskyy was quoted saying, according to Interfax-Ukraine news agency.
But that's not all! Zelenskyy is also thinking ahead. He suggested that after joining NATO, Ukraine could work to diplomatically regain territories currently controlled by Russia. Talk about playing the long game! 🎯
He emphasized the importance of a ceasefire to ensure Russia doesn't make any more surprise moves. \"A ceasefire is necessary to guarantee that Russia does not return\" to seize more Ukrainian territory, he stressed.
Meanwhile, Russia's response? Pretty low-key. The Kremlin has been silent on Zelenskyy's proposal. 🤔 But Leonid Slutsky, chairman of the International Affairs Committee of the Russian State Duma, had something to say on his Telegram channel. He called on Ukrainian politicians to ditch their NATO dreams, stating, \"Kyiv is seeking to join NATO; this is the key to moving forward, not the end of the war. The idea of freezing the conflict is also unacceptable.\"
Adding fuel to the fire, the Russian Defense Ministry reported that in the fall of 2024, the Russian army \"liberated\" 88 settlements in the Donetsk, Luhansk, Zaporizhzhia, and Kharkiv regions, as well as the Kursk region, which Ukraine had reportedly entered earlier this year.
